Club América are reportedly close to signing Necaxa goalkeeper Luis Malagón amid uncertainty over the future of Las Águilas’ current number one, Guillermo Ochoa.

Malagón fee agreed - Superdeportivo’s Merlo

According to Superdeportivo journalist César Merlo, América have agreed a fee with Necaxa for Malagón, whose value is estimated by Transfermarkt at 3.5 million euros. The 13-time Mexican champions’ second signing of the close-season period could be confirmed in the coming days.

América have already added Puebla defender Israel Reyes to their ranks ahead of the Liga MX Clausura 2023 tournament, which begins in early January.

A product of the Morelia youth academy, Malagón joined Necaxa in 2020, establishing himself as a fixture in the team at the Estadio Victoria. In total, he made 72 appearances for the club.

Malagón’s role at América

As América continue to negotiate a new contract with Ochoa - whose present deal expires at the end of December - it remains unclear what Malagón’s role in Fernando Ortiz’s squad would be.

If, as expected, Ochoa does agree an extension, Malagón would be back-up to the 37-year-old. The current second-choice keeper, Óscar Jiménez, is likely to leave in search of regular first-team football.

Querétaro up first for América

América, who reached the semi-finals of the Apertura 2022 tournament, kick off their Clausura 2023 campaign at home to Querétaro on 7 January.
